* Asthma is a common chronic disease among children in the United States.
* In 2006, 9.9 million children under 18 years of age were reported to have ever been diagnosed with asthma; 6.8 million children had an asthmatic episode in the last 12 months. * The hospitalization rate for asthma remained at 27 per 10,000 children from 2002-2004. * Asthma is the third ranking cause of non-injury related hospitalization among children less than 15 years of age.
* Although asthma deaths among children are rare, 195 children under 18 years of age died from asthma in 2003.
Disparities of Asthma * Asthma disproportionately affects children from lower-income families and children from various racial and ethnic groups.
* African-American children have a 500% higher mortality rate from asthma as compared with Caucasian children.
* In 2005, 13% of African-American children were reported to have asthma as compared with 9% of Hispanic children and 8% of non-Hispanic white children.
